Marty Clary Career WHIP Overview

Marty Clary's WHIP was 1.444 for his 3-year Major League Baseball career. 1989 was his best season when his WHIP was 1.233 and his worst season was 1990 when his WHIP was 1.643. Walks and hits per innings pitched (WHIP) is a metric that shows how often, on average, hitters get on base per inning against a pitcher. It is calcuated by summing hits and walks for a give time period then dividing by the number of innings during that time period. Generally, for WHIP, lower is better. (Source)
